Output 84f53c228b92d30e02578e5384f8f48eeb6c4540286fba498b50da0251dbab9d:1

value
1361261
script pubkey
OP_0 OP_PUSHBYTES_20 5e0aeb78b055e897dee04d2c70afdb7fc7666910
address
bc1qtc9wk79s2h5f0hhqf5k8pt7m0lrkv6gsm8rk9a
transaction
84f53c228b92d30e02578e5384f8f48eeb6c4540286fba498b50da0251dbab9d
confirmations
142648
spent
true